Desarrollo de software: qué frameworks son los más populares

Los framework para desarrollo de software más utilizados en el 2022

framework de desarrollo de software

Los lenguajes de programación evolucionan al ritmo de las necesidades de los usuarios. Los frameworks para desarrollo de software tienen mucho que ver con estos avances a nivel de programación. Son herramientas clave para facilitar el trabajo de los desarrolladores de software. 

¿Cuáles son los frameworks de mayor uso en el 2022? Conozcamos algunos de los más populares, y las características que los definen; además veremos algunas empresas muy conocidas que están haciendo uso de estos frameworks. 

Los 5 mejores frameworks para el desarrollo de software

Los mejores frameworks de desarrollo

Es extensa la lista actualizada de frameworks para el desarrollo de software. Y aunque varía de un autor a otro, la mayoría coinciden en algunos nombres destacados: Laravel, Meteor, Ruby on Rails, Flaks, Angular, Cake PHP, Phalcon, Zend y Apache Struts. Hemos seleccionado solo 5 de estos frameworks para verlos en detalle.

Laravel

Se trata de uno de los frameworks PHP más completos y prácticos. La mayoría de los programadores destacan su elegante sintaxis y fácil manejo. ¿Qué otras características destacar de Laravel?

  • Alto rendimiento al integrar funciones de enrutamiento, administración de usuarios y almacenamiento, entre otras.
  • Escalabilidad para ampliar utilizando variedad de extensiones
  • Amplia compatibilidad con varias bibliotecas y plataformas (AWS)
  • Una gran comunidad de usuarios

Flask

Es un micro framework para trabajar en Python. Pero no hay que confundir el término micro con la funcionalidad de Flask. Más bien se refiere a la posibilidad que brinda a los programadores de empezar proyectos e ir incorporando funciones a la medida del software. ¿Qué ventajas ofrece Flask?

  • Desarrollo de apps sencillas en el patrón MVC
  • Acceder a un gran número de plugins 
  • Integra un depurador para pruebas unitarias
  • Opera en la modalidad de código abierto

Symfony

Este es una herramienta PHP de código abierto que destaca por su opción de modularidad; lo cual es muy conveniente para programadores que no necesitan usar una biblioteca completa, sino algunas funciones del framework. 

Una particularidad de Symfony es que integra una función de prueba para asegurar el buen desempeño de las aplicaciones creadas. Además es una herramienta adaptable para todo tipo de desarrollos, tanto webs sencillas como aplicaciones avanzadas.

Angular

Se trata de otro framework open source, en este caso es para JavaScript. Es uno de los más robustos, ideal para sitios webs que requieren una gran arquitectura (MVC). Uno de los atractivos de esta herramienta es su calidad y constante actualización. Estas son sus características relevantes:

  • Muy útil al momento de implementar múltiples scripts en sitios web
  • Es escalable y modular
  • Permite desarrollar sitios web que manejan un gran volumen de tráfico y aplicaciones robustas

Django

Destaca entre los frameworks para desarrollo de software por la seguridad que ofrece. A esto hay que añadir que es gratuita y de código abierto. Django es una herramienta muy completa que está respaldada por un grupo bien nutrido de desarrolladores experimentados, que hacen grandes aportes para mejorarla.

Entre sus ventajas destaca la compatibilidad con varios formatos: XML y HTML, entre otros. Es la herramienta elegida por programadores por su manejo intuitivo y amplia funcionalidad con múltiples paquetes de calidad probada. Quizá su única desventaja sea su velocidad ante otros frameworks.

El aporte de los frameworks al desarrollo empresarial 

Continuamos con Django, y es que son muchas las grandes marcas que están haciendo uso de este framewok para desarrollar software:

  • Instagram
  • The New York Times
  • Mercedes –Benz
  • National Geographic
  • The Washington Post

Por otro lado sabemos que Pziher hace uso de Laravel; así como otras aplicaciones menos conocidas, por ejemplo: Koel. Esta es una app diseñada para escuchar música en streaming. Con Ruby on Rails se han diseñado websites muy famosos: Shopify y GitHub, incluso, Twitter sigue usando este framework en su interfaz de usuario.

Preguntas Frecuentes

¿Qué es un framework y para qué sirve?

Un framework, en términos informáticos, es el marco, modelo, plantilla o patrón donde se construye un software. Es una herramienta que brinda muchas funcionalidades al momento de crear y dar mantenimiento a sitios webs y aplicaciones móviles. Generalmente los frameworks son compatibles con un tipo de lenguaje de programación en particular, o con varios de ellos.

 ¿Cuál es el framework más usado?

Haciendo una revisión en los principales portales de tecnología e informática, encontramos que Laravel ocupa el primer lugar como el framework más usado en el 2022. Seguido por Django, Flask, Express JS y Ruby on Rails.

¿Cuáles son los tipos de framework?

Según el género de programación, podemos distinguir de forma básica, tres tipos de frameworks: para aplicaciones web, de DataScience y para desarrollo de apps móviles.

Recuerda que en Atlantic Technologies contamos con equipos de desarrollo dedicados que ofrecen una gama amplia de soluciones a nuestros clientes. Solita información y deja tu proyecto en las manos de profesionales.

Tags: No tags

Add a Comment

Your email address will not be published. Required fields are marked*